1996 Mercedes-Benz SLK review from UK and Ireland
"Enjoyable open top cruiser."
What things have gone wrong with the car?
Minor irritants, especially electrical e.g. brake light works loose, drivers door mirror de-icer does not work (although garage say there is nothing wrong).
General comments?
Heavy on fuel, servicing expensive (it's a Mercedes, what do you expect?) not really a sports car (cornering poor, auto gearbox - difficult to get into right gear without using gear lever soft ride), more a sporty Gran Turismo.
